Lyshae is a unique and modern name that has gained popularity in recent years. The name Lyshae is of American origin and has no specific meaning. It is believed to be a combination of two names, Lysandra and Shae, which are both Greek in origin. Lysandra means "liberator" or "defender," while Shae means "admirable" or "gift." The combination of these two names creates a unique and beautiful name that is both feminine and strong.

Lyshae is a unisex name, but it is more commonly used for girls. The name Lyshae is pronounced as LYE-shay. The name has a soft and melodic sound, making it a popular choice for parents who are looking for a unique and beautiful name for their daughter. The name Lyshae is not commonly used as a surname.

The name Lyshae has no significant historical background, as it is a modern name that has only recently gained popularity. However, the name has become increasingly popular in the United States in recent years, particularly among African American parents.
